Output 18218c056923a70e38c82ec64e925277c6aef61bff2457e8d5f2541bc728000c:0

value
1674261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d83479f790a9645a6cfc15fadb76e910aeed1a2 OP_EQUAL
address
3ADU2rzjdMBmqj7MZzGaJnCiQJRDUbCHUg
transaction
18218c056923a70e38c82ec64e925277c6aef61bff2457e8d5f2541bc728000c
confirmations
288928
spent
true